2. Challenges Of Recycling Solar Panels



It is commonly accepted that recycling photovoltaic panels has numerous ecological advantages, nonetheless, it is additionally true that the procedure isn't without its difficulties. Yet what exactly are these difficulties? Allow's explore better.



One of the largest issues with reusing solar panels is the complexity of the task itself. It can be challenging to break down the different parts, such as glass and steel, to be reused separately. Additionally, solar panel makers typically have a mix of products used in their products which makes sorting them even more complicated. Additionally, there are safety and wellness risks involved with taking care of broken glass or breathing in fumes from thawing components.

One more crucial challenge connected with recycling photovoltaic panels is price. Lots of nations do not have enough facilities or sources to sufficiently reuse these items which brings about higher expenses for organizations attempting to do so. In addition, as a result of the specific nature of reusing photovoltaic panels, this can create a monetary problem on companies attempting to stay compliant with regulations. Inevitably, these prices could be passed down to customers making it hard for them to afford renewable resource sources.
